Once you had the node monitored thru SNMP, do a Rediscover from the node details page, wait a minute and then click on List Ressources. You should see "Hardware Health Sensors" at the top of the list.

Queries with spaces in column names works fine in SWQL Studio, but they break in 2020.2.5 dashboards. Simply removing spaces in columns (ie: like in [RELATED NODE] ) should fix it...

I was told by support that the Hardware Health on Gen10 servers requires and work only via SNMP at the moment. The SolarWinds Agent is basically a WMI proxy. I suggest you vote for the feature request so this is getting traction at the Product Manager level so it's implemented in a future release.

I had the same issues, and was not able to communicate with the 2012 server. By creating the LocalAccountTokenFilterPolicy reg key (Description of User Account Control and remote restrictions in Windows Vista), it fixed my issue.
